Overview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g Tablet SR

Neuropathic pain is treated with the prescription medication,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g Tablet SR. Its mechanism involves modulating nerve cell calcium channels to reduce pain, while also safeguarding and repairing damaged nerve fibers. Administered orally, with or without food, ideally at bedtime for consistent blood levels, the medication should be taken as directed by your physician. Due to its habit-forming nature, adhere strictly to the prescribed dosage and duration. Missed doses should be taken promptly upon recollection. Complete the full course of treatment, even with symptom improvement. Sudden cessation requires prior consultation with your doctor. Common, generally mild and transient side effects encompass nasopharyngitis, increased appetite, elevated mood, tremors, blurred vision, dry mouth, dizziness, and somnolence. Avoid activities requiring alertness until the drug's effects are understood. Weight gain is possible; mitigate this through exercise and a balanced diet. Report any unusual mood or behavioral shifts, new or worsening depression, or suicidal ideation to your physician. Disclose all other medications you are taking, as interactions may compromise efficacy or alter the drug's action. Pregnancy, pregnancy planning, or breastfeeding should be communicated to your doctor.

How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g Tablet SR works:

Each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g sustained-release tablet unites methylcobalamin, a vitamin B derivative crucial for myelin sheath production and nerve cell repair, with pregabalin, an alpha-2-delta ligand. Pregabalin's mechanism involves modulating nerve cell calcium channels to reduce pain signaling. This synergistic action targets and alleviates neuropathic pain resulting from nerve damage.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Concomitant use of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g sustained-release tablets and alcohol can lead to heightened somnolence.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Use of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g SR tablets during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ible dangers before prescribing. Consult your doctor for adv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Extended-release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g tablets are likely not safe for breastfeeding mothers. Available human data indicates potential transfer to breast milk, posing a ris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Driving should be avoided if you experience drowsiness, blurred vision, or dizziness after taking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g SR tablets, as this medication may impair alertness and coordination.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Patients with kidney impairment should use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g sustained-release tablets cautiously. Dosage modification of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g sustained-release tablets may be necessary. Medical advice is recommended.

LiverLiverS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

The use of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g sustained-release tablets in individuals with hepatic impairment is likely safe. Existing evidence indicates dose modification may be unnecessary, however, medical consultation is recommended.

FAQs on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g Tablet SR

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g SR tablets combine pregabalin and methylcobalamin to manage neuropathic pain. By affecting the brain, it soothes damaged or overly active nerves, reducing pain perception and promoting nerve regeneration.
Don't discontinue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g Tablet SR even if your pain subsides. Follow your doctor's instructions. Abrupt cessation may cause withdrawal symptoms including anxiety, insomnia, nausea, pain, and sweating. A gradual reduction is recommended before completely stopping the medication.
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g SR Tablets may increase appetite, potentially leading to weight gain. Preventing this weight gain is simpler than losing it later. Maintain a healthy, balanced diet without increasing portion sizes. Limit high-calorie foods like soft drinks, fried foods, chips, sweets, and baked goods. If hungry between meals, choose fruits, vegetables, and low-calorie options instead of junk food. Regular exercise will also help. Combining a healthy diet and regular exercise can help you avoid weight gain.
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g SR Tablets can cause drowsiness or sudden sleep onset, sometimes without warning. Therefore, avoid driving, operating machinery, working at heights, or engaging in hazardous activities, especially when starting treatment, until you understand the drug's effects on you. Report any such episodes to your doctor.
While rare,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g Tablet SR can cause serious side effects, including allergic reactions and suicidal thoughts, or swelling in the extremities (hands, feet, or legs). Discontinue use and seek immediate medical attention if you experience any of these: allergic reactions (facial, mouth, lip, gum, tongue, or neck swelling; breathing difficulties; rash; hives; or blisters); or significant mood, behavioral, thought, or feeling changes, including suicidal ideation.
You may notice some improvement with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g Tablet SR within two weeks, but the complete benefits may take two to three months, or longer in some cases.
Missed a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g Tablet SR dose? If your next dose is nearly due, skip the missed one and continue as usual. Otherwise, take it immediately and resume your regular schedule. Never double up on doses to compensate; this can cause side effects. If uncertain, contact your doctor for guidance.
Increasing your dosage beyond the recommended amount won't necessarily improve results; it could actually lead to severe side effects and toxicity. If your symptoms worsen despite taking the prescribed dose, consult your doctor for further assessment.
Avoid alcohol while taking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g Tablet SR; alcohol may worsen the drowsiness this medication can cause.
Regular check-ups with your doctor are recommended while taking Montpreg 1500mcg/75mg Tablet SR. Consult your doctor if your symptoms don't improve with the prescribed dosage or if you experience bothersome side effects impacting your daily life.
Don't open the tablet packaging until you're ready to take your medication. Store the package in a cool, dry place, away from children. Dispose of any unused medication properly to prevent accidental ingestion by children, pets, or others.
